STL225N6F7AG - STMicroelectronics

Description: Automotive-grade N-channel 60 V, 1.2 mΩ typ., 120 A STripFET™ F7 Power MOSFET in a PowerFLAT™ 5x6 package

STL225N6F7AG Frequently Asked Questions (FAQs)

  • STMicroelectronics recommends a 2-layer PCB with a thermal pad connected to a large copper area on the bottom layer to dissipate heat efficiently.
  • Ensure proper thermal management, use a heat sink if necessary, and follow the recommended operating conditions and derating guidelines in the datasheet.
  • The maximum allowed voltage on the gate pin is ±20V, but it's recommended to keep it within ±15V to ensure reliable operation and prevent damage.
  • Yes, the STL225N6F7AG is suitable for high-frequency switching applications up to 1 MHz, but ensure proper PCB layout and decoupling to minimize ringing and EMI.
  • Use a TVS diode or a zener diode to protect against overvoltage, and consider adding a current sense resistor and a fuse to protect against overcurrent.

About STMicroelectronics

STMicroelectronics (ST) is a global semiconductor company that designs, manufactures, and markets a broad range of integrated circuits (ICs), discrete devices, and other electronic components. STMicroelectronics offers a diverse portfolio of semiconductor products covering a wide range of applications and industries.
